Is it still possible to cause damage if I touch/hit tip of my nose 9 months post rhinoplasty?

anuser19
Hello! I had a closed rhinoplasty nine (almost 10) months ago. One side of my tip is still very swollen. Today and two days ago, I accidentally touched the tip of my nose a bit harsher than usual (it was so light you can't even call it hit) and I felt a weak pain. My nose didn't become red or more swollen. Neither does it still hurt. And the appearance of my nose didn't change. I'm still very afraid I could have caused any damage. Is it possible to still cause damage? Thank you!
